

Small Pulmonary Nodules Clinic
What this program does...
Small Pulmonary Nodules is an interdisciplinary clinic between Respirology and Thoracic Surgery that rapidly assesses, manages and follows patients with solitary or multiple pulmonary nodules.
How this program helps...
This program provides quick, appropriate and timely interdisciplinary assessment in cases of suspected lung cancer or metastatic spread to the lungs by a team of highly skilled Respirologists and Thoracic Surgeons.
